]] Guillem Jover | * Small logical unit commits (if it cannot be described fully in the | short summary, then there's probably too many changes): | - Others do not get put off by monster commits, or trying to mentally | untangle the unrelated changes in their minds. | - Makes it easier to verify for correctness, avoid regressions, etc. | - Makes it easier to revert or cherry-pick if needed.
As buxy pointed out: how do you think we should do this wrt larger features?
